One of the best things about Joomla is its ease of use and the ability of the user to edit their own content. Many developers and implementers sell Joomla to clients because the client can keep their sites updated on their own. The only problem is that client's don't know Joomla usually. How does a developer or implementer go about training their client's to use Joomla effectively?

This session will teach the teachers how to train their client's on using Joomla. We'll cover the Ins and Outs of how client's learn and the most effective ways to teach certain aspects of Joomla to your clients. The participants will get first hand experience on what it feels like to sit on the OTHER side of the table as an end-user instead of being the teacher.
